edu::tum::cs::srl::mln::inference::MCSAT Class Reference

Inheritance diagram for edu::tum::cs::srl::mln::inference::MCSAT:
Inheritance graph
[legend]

List of all members.

Public Member Functions

String getAlgorithmName ()
double getResult (GroundAtom ga)
ArrayList< InferenceResultinfer (Iterable< String > queries, int maxSteps) throws Exception
 MCSAT (MarkovRandomField mrf) throws Exception

Package Attributes

edu.tum.cs.logic.sat.weighted.MCSAT sampler

Detailed Description

Definition at line 15 of file srl/mln/inference/MCSAT.java.


Constructor & Destructor Documentation

edu::tum::cs::srl::mln::inference::MCSAT::MCSAT ( MarkovRandomField  mrf  )  throws Exception [inline]

Definition at line 19 of file srl/mln/inference/MCSAT.java.


Member Function Documentation

String edu::tum::cs::srl::mln::inference::MCSAT::getAlgorithmName (  )  [inline]
double edu::tum::cs::srl::mln::inference::MCSAT::getResult ( GroundAtom  ga  )  [inline, virtual]
ArrayList<InferenceResult> edu::tum::cs::srl::mln::inference::MCSAT::infer ( Iterable< String >  queries,
int  maxSteps 
) throws Exception [inline, virtual]

Member Data Documentation

Definition at line 17 of file srl/mln/inference/MCSAT.java.


The documentation for this class was generated from the following file:
 All Classes Namespaces Files Functions Variables Enumerations


srldb
Author(s): Dominik Jain, Stefan Waldherr, Moritz Tenorth
autogenerated on Fri Jan 11 09:58:45 2013